PTGX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

274 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Protagonist Therapeutics (PTGX)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$4.7B — up 20% from $3.92B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 42 funds opened new PTGX positions and 38 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 84 added to existing stakes and 109 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Marshall Wace, opening a new position worth an estimated $61.7M. The largest seller was Deep Track Capital, cutting an estimated $87M.
